Speaking during a recent public forum, Murkomen highlighted the evolving nature of these gangs, emphasizing that they often originate from seemingly harmless beginnings.

Some of these gangs are yours, while others belong to your rivals,” Murkomen said, stressing the political dimension that has often been overlooked in discussions about crime. He explained that many young men begin as bouncers or informal security personnel, gradually evolving into violent criminal outfits if political patronage or negligence allows it.

He also outlined the pattern of transformation, noting that these groups typically progress from bouncers to goons and eventually full fledged gangs with significant influence in their neighborhoods.

He warned that politicians who indirectly support such groups, even for protection or political advantage, risk destabilizing their constituencies and undermining public safety.

Murkomen also called on law enforcement agencies to intensify efforts to dismantle these networks before they reach a stage where they can influence political outcomes.

It is not just about crime on the streets. This is about how politics and criminality intersect. Ignoring this reality will have severe consequences for our democracy and public order,” he saidAnalysts note that criminal groups often exploit political rivalries and loyalties, making them harder to dismantle and creating long-term security challenges for the country.

Murkomen urged politicians to take a proactive stance by distancing themselves from any associations with these groups and instead supporting community programs that provide youth with alternatives to crime.

He warned that continued tolerance of such networks would ultimately lead to chaos, affecting not just local communities but the political landscape at large.

By drawing attention to the intersection of politics and criminal gangs, Murkomen’s remarks highlight a growing concern in the country the need for accountability among leaders and the responsibility to ensure public safety is not compromised for political gain.
